A Brief Overview of Steam’s Policy
Steam’s Community Guidelines and Terms of Service outline the platform’s stance on mature content. The guidelines clearly state that Steam aims to provide a "civilized" environment for its users, where users can "enjoy" their games without being subjected to excessive profanity or mature content. The guidelines also prohibit the use of explicit language, hate speech, and other forms of offensive behavior.
Why Swearing is Censored on Steam
There are several reasons why Steam censors swearing on its platform:
• Protection of Minors: Steam is a family-friendly platform that allows gamers of all ages to play and interact with each other. Censoring swearing ensures that young gamers are not exposed to mature content that may not be suitable for their age.
• Community Guidelines: Steam’s community guidelines aim to maintain a respectful and positive gaming environment. By censoring swearing, Steam encourages gamers to engage in respectful communication and helps maintain a community that is free from negativity and hostility.
• In-Game Chat Filter: Steam’s in-game chat filter allows users to set a language filter to automatically block or replace explicit words with more appropriate alternatives. This feature helps to prevent users from inadvertently sharing profanity-laced language, ensuring a cleaner and more family-friendly gaming environment.
• Avoidance of Controversy: Censoring swearing on Steam helps to avoid controversy and ensures that the platform does not become a source of conflict or tension among gamers.
